Table 37. Accumulation Mode Register (ACCMODE, Address 0x0F)
Bit
Mnemonic
Default Description
7
ICHANNEL1
0
6
FAULTSIGN1
0
This bit indicates the current channel used to measure energy in antitampering mode.
0 = Channel A (IPA)
1 = Channel B (IPB)
Configuration bit to select the event that triggers a fault interrupt.
0 = FAULT interrupt occurs when part enters fault mode
1 = FAULT interrupt occurs when part enters normal mode
5
VARSIGN2
0
Configuration bit to select the event that triggers a reactive power sign interrupt. If cleared to 0,
a VARSIGN interrupt occurs when reactive power changes from positive to negative. If set to 1, a
VARSIGN interrupt occurs when reactive power changes from negative to positive.
4
APSIGN
0
Configuration bit to select event that triggers an active power sign interrupt. If cleared to 0, an
APSIGN interrupt occurs when active power changes from positive to negative. If set to 1, an
APSIGN interrupt occurs when active power changes from negative to positive.
3
ABSVARM2
0
Logic 1 enables absolute value accumulation of reactive power in energy register and pulse
output.
2
SAVARM2
0
Logic 1 enables reactive power accumulation depending on the sign of the active power. If
active power is positive, var is accumulated as it is. If active power is negative, the sign of the var
is reversed for the accumulation. This accumulation mode affects both the var registers (VARHR,
RVARHR, LVARHR) and the pulse output when connected to var.2
1
POAM
0
Logic 1 enables positive-only accumulation of active power in energy register and pulse output.
0
ABSAM
0
Logic 1 enables absolute value accumulation of active power in energy register and pulse
output.
1 This function is not available in the ADE7566 or ADE7569.
2 This function is not available in the ADE7116, ADE7156, ADE7166, or ADE7566.
